Psyber X: The Latest First-Person Shooter on Steam with NFT Integration
Psyber X is the latest addition to the world of fully live games, offering a thrilling first-person shooter experience.

Psyber X built on Unreal Engine 5, is free to play with Web3 options and available on the popular Steam gaming platform.
The P2E game combines a dark urban theme with fantasy elements. These elements include psychic attacks and mythical creatures, making the game a skill-based battle with stunning effects.
Alpha Access and Optional NFTs
Currently, in the closed alpha stage, Psyber X offers tournaments and special access targeting the Discord community. Upon its full launch, the game will include first-person and third-person views, various battle modes, and battle royale. The game has also introduced an optional NFT element. It allows players to buy crates containing weapons, attack cards, and powers.
Psyber X has spent a long time selling NFT collections, with the first ones selling out quickly, especially the Founder Starter Kit. However, creators have designed the game keeping gamers in mind, and earnings from NFT sales are only a small part of the community. The game offers:
- basic starter kit crates,
- land plots in the game's metaverse, and
- a collection of commercial plots for passive income, which have already sold out.
As per the announcement, participants will need passes to enter tournaments and special events. Onboarding into Psyber X involves buying starter packs and passes, with open access available since February for independent testing. The game uses the Hive account infrastructure and the KeyChain login tool, which enables traditional gamers to enter Web3 easily. Meanwhile, Psyber X is a partner of the Avalanche blockchain. The partnership adds a valuable feature to the growing portfolio of Avalanche games.
